Position: HS Certified Music Teacher / Piano Accompanist

Certified Music Teacher/Piano Accompanist

To provide piano and keyboard accompaniment for choir classes, rehearsals, and performances as scheduled by the secondary choir directors. Support student learning and performance readiness by assisting in the preparation of concerts, UIL events, and other choral performances. Also, provide accompaniment support for select elementary choir rehearsals and performances and select band solo and ensemble rehearsals and contests as assigned. Promote high levels of student achievement while supporting a collaborative, high-quality Fine Arts program across campuses.

High school diploma or equivalent required; advanced musical training preferred

Strong sight-reading and accompaniment skills

Knowledge of vocal and choral rehearsal techniques

Ability to collaborate effectively with directors and students

Strong organizational, communication, and interpersonal skills

Ability to adapt to multiple campus schedules and performance demands

Prior experience accompanying school choirs, ensembles, or similar performance groups preferred

Accompany middle school and high school choir classes, rehearsals, concerts, UIL events, and performances

Support daily instructional activities by providing consistent musical accompaniment aligned with directors instruction

Assist in preparing students for performances, contests, and adjudicated events

Provide accompaniment for select elementary choir rehearsals and performances

Provide accompaniment for select band solo and ensemble rehearsals and contests as assigned

Support student development of musical accuracy, confidence, and performance readiness

Collaborate with directors to enhance student learning and achievement in Fine Arts

Contribute to a performance culture that promotes excellence and discipline

Work closely with choir directors, band directors, and campus staff to support program needs

Maintain professional communication with staff, students, and administration

Demonstrate flexibility in scheduling rehearsals and performances across multiple campuses

Maintain punctuality, preparedness, and professionalism at all rehearsals and performances

Support campus and district Fine Arts goals and initiatives

Perform other duties as assigned in support of the Fine Arts program

Maintain emotional control under pressure. Frequent standing, sitting, and extended performance/rehearsal schedules. Occasional evening and weekend commitments. Ability to transport and set up personal or district keyboard equipment as needed. Work across multiple campuses and performance venues
